The Puppeteer's Predicament: The Enchanted Strings of Willow's Whim

Once upon a time, in a quaint village nestled between rolling hills and whispering forests, there lived a young girl named Willow. She was not like other girls her age; she had a peculiar talent that set her apart. Willow could manipulate strings, a skill she had inherited from her grandmother, who had been a famous puppeteer in her day. Willow spent her days crafting intricate puppets, each with its own unique personality and story.

The village was a place of enchantment, where the line between the mundane and the magical was often blurred. Willow's grandmother had told her tales of enchanted strings that could bring puppets to life, but Willow had never believed in such fantastical things. Until one fateful day.

As Willow was weaving a new string for a puppet, she felt a strange pull. Her fingers tingled with an energy she had never felt before. The string began to glow, and as she pulled it taut, a soft hum filled the room. To her astonishment, the string coiled around her wrist and a tiny, golden figure emerged from it, its eyes twinkling with life.

Willow's heart leaped with joy. She had created a living puppet, and it was the most beautiful thing she had ever seen. She named the puppet Lila, and they became inseparable. Willow spent her nights dreaming of adventures with Lila, exploring the enchanted realm that seemed to exist just beyond the village.

But as time passed, Willow began to notice strange occurrences. The enchanted strings were not just bringing puppets to life; they were also weaving a web of destiny. Willow's puppets were starting to affect the villagers, changing their fates in ways she couldn't control. Some became happier, while others found themselves in situations they couldn't escape.

One day, a young boy named Max approached Willow. His eyes were filled with fear and desperation. "Please, Willow," he said, "help me. My father is a greedy merchant, and he's planning to sell the enchanted strings to a dark sorcerer. If he does, the village will be cursed."

Willow knew she had to act. She had to find a way to stop the greedy merchant and save the enchanted strings. But as she delved deeper into the mystery, she discovered that the strings were more powerful than she had ever imagined. They were the threads of fate, and their magic was both a gift and a burden.

With Lila by her side, Willow set out on a perilous journey. They traveled through enchanted forests, crossed treacherous rivers, and faced mythical creatures. Along the way, Willow met other puppeteers, each with their own story and connection to the enchanted strings.

One of the puppeteers, an old woman named Elara, revealed the truth about the enchanted strings. "These strings are not just toys," she said. "They are the essence of life itself. They hold the memories and dreams of everyone who has ever lived. If they fall into the wrong hands, the world will be lost."

As Willow and her friends continued their quest, they faced their greatest challenge yet. The greedy merchant had captured Lila and was using her to control the enchanted strings. Willow knew she had to save her friend, but she also had to save the strings from the dark sorcerer who sought to use them for his own evil purposes.

In a climactic battle, Willow and her friends fought with all their might. Willow used her strings to ensnare the sorcerer, while her friends fought off his minions. But the sorcerer was not to be defeated so easily. He unleashed a powerful spell that threatened to destroy everything Willow had worked so hard to save.

In a moment of desperation, Willow turned to Lila. "Lila, you must be the one to break the spell," she whispered. Lila nodded, her eyes filled with determination. Willow tied the enchanted strings around her wrist and felt the magic surge through her.

With a powerful pull, Willow yanked the strings, breaking the spell. The sorcerer's dark aura dissipated, and the enchanted strings returned to their rightful place. The village was saved, and the enchanted realm was once again at peace.

Willow and her friends returned to the village as heroes. The villagers celebrated their bravery, and Willow's puppets became a symbol of hope and magic. Willow realized that the enchanted strings were not just a source of power; they were a reminder of the strength of friendship and the courage to face one's fears.

From that day on, Willow continued to craft puppets, each one a story of hope and adventure. She taught others the art of string manipulation, ensuring that the magic would never be forgotten. And whenever she looked at Lila, she knew that together, they could overcome any challenge.

And so, the village lived in harmony, with the enchanted strings as a reminder of the magic that existed in the world. Willow's adventures were told for generations, inspiring young and old alike to believe in the power of friendship and the magic that lived within us all.
